At 17 I'd focus on eating, get in a good post workout meal. Even at twice your age I try to get in a good meal with some healthy fats, complex carbs and 20-30g of protein after a workout if possible. If a full meal is out of the question, a good glass of milk, some cottage cheese, greek yogurt or a tuna sandwich always works
